Steroids are performance-enhancing drugs that have been banned in professional baseball for more than two decades. The use of steroids has long been a controversial topic in the world of sports, and the debate over whether or not they should be legalized in baseball is ongoing.

On one hand, proponents of steroid legalization argue that it would level the playing field and allow all players to compete equally. They argue that if some players are already using steroids illegally, then it would be fairer to legalize the drugs and allow all players to use them openly. This would also eliminate the need for players to risk their health and careers by using steroids secretly.

However, there are also many compelling reasons why steroids should not be legalized in baseball. First and foremost, steroids are harmful to an individual's health. Long-term use of steroids can lead to a range of serious health problems, including liver damage, kidney damage, and an increased risk of heart attack and stroke. Additionally, steroids can have negative psychological effects, such as mood swings and aggression.

Another reason why steroids should not be legalized in baseball is that they give users an unfair advantage. Steroids can help athletes build muscle mass and strength, which can give them a significant advantage over their opponents. This creates an uneven playing field and undermines the integrity of the sport.

Furthermore, legalizing steroids in baseball would send a poor message to young athletes, who may feel pressure to use performance-enhancing drugs in order to succeed. This could lead to an increase in steroid use among young athletes, which could have serious health consequences.

In conclusion, while there may be some arguments in favor of legalizing steroids in baseball, the risks to an individual's health and the unfair advantage they provide make it clear that they should remain banned. The health and well-being of athletes should be the top priority, and allowing the use of performance-enhancing drugs would only serve to undermine the integrity and fairness of the sport.
